RUSTIC REEL Chestnut contra - 1850s forward. This from Deborah Hyland of St. Louis Three-face-three Sicilian, man with two women. Half-length dance. A: Men with their right-hand opposite lady chasse out (c. 3 slips) and back; keep moving to chasse with left-hand opposite and back. B: Lines of three forward and back. Forward again and pass through (which leaves about two measures over; so maybe adopt a "Three Meet"-type lines pass by right shoulder?)
